Breathing in ozone can cause coughing, throat irritation, and worsen existing lung conditions like asthma. High levels in summer attributed to vehicle emissions, wildfire smoke, and weather.
Wildfires, such as the Post Fire in California, contribute to ozone formation and poor air quality. Monitoring ozone levels through AirNow.gov and EnviroFlash is recommended for timely alerts.
